LEVELS OF GOVERNMENT

Toronto’s municipal government is responsible for Such services as streets, garbage collection, snow removal and recreation and parks. The municipality can also be involved in property development, company regulations, and cultural and civic pursuits. Elementary and secondary schools are run by local school boards. You will find 25 City Councillors.

The provincial government is responsible for Matters within the boundaries of the Province of Ontario. You will find 22 Members of Ontario’s Provincial Parliament (MPPs) that represent the inhabitants of Toronto at the Legislative Meeting in Queen’s Park in Toronto.

The National government is responsible for things Seeing Canada as a whole. You will find 22 Members of Parliament (MPs) that signify Toronto’s residents from the national House of Commons at Ottawa.

WEATHER IN TORONTO

Get the current weather conditions from Toronto, Too As historic averages.

Generally, Toronto’s weather follows patterns For all those four seasons:

Spring is a fairly rainy season in Toronto with day Temperatures climbing as summer approaches while nights stay cool. The average temperature throughout the day is roughly 12°C in March, April and early May.

Summer in Toronto is at its warmest in July and August, With daytime temperatures averaging over 20°C and often rising over 30°C. Alerts are occasionally broadcast to frighten the general public about dangers from extreme levels of warmth, sunlight and smog.

Fall, or fall, starts in September with gentle temperatures Falling steadily before the snowy winter season starts in December. The season is distinguished by the changing of the leaves that vary from green to shades of crimson, yellow and orange before falling into the floor.

Winter is Toronto’s coldest season, with temperatures Usually under 0°C and snow falling often. January and February will be the Coldest weeks where temperatures could fall below -25°C. Alerts are Occasionally broadcast to warn the general public about dangers from extreme cold weather.
